Case study · MSHA Record #219882010002
Haul/Off Road/Coal/Ore/Pit/Quarry/Rock/Rubber Tire Truck Driver fatality
July 5, 1988 at 10:55 AM
Loudoun Quarries
· Loudoun Quarries-Div/Chantilly Crushed Stone Inc
· Loudoun County, VA
Investigator narrative
EMPLS ENTERED BIN TO UNCLOG CHUTE.MATERIAL WAS BRIDGED OVER.BRIDGE GAVE WAY BURYING 2 EMPL.EMPL WERENT WEARING SAFETY BELTS.
